Abstract:
The first observations of uv optical and magneto-optical spectra for bulk, single-crystal ferric oxide compounds are reported. Measurements were made on rare earth orthoferrites, rare earth iron garnets, nickel ferrite, and ferrimagnetic magneto-plumbite. In particular these results include the first uv measurements of the complex polar Kerr effect for any material. The magneto-optical measurement technique complex polar Kerr effect is discussed, the experimental hardware is described, and the data is analyzed in terms of a molecular orbital theory which elaborates on earlier theories by Clogston.
